Seika Machinery Offers Service and Repairs for Its Leading Brands
August 4, 2022 | Seika Machinery, Inc.Estimated reading time: Less than a minute

Seika Machinery, Inc., a leading provider of advanced machinery, materials and engineering services, is pleased to offer service and support for Sawa ultrasonic portable cleaners, SC-500HE and SC-5000GUS McDry dry cabinets, and calibration for Malcom viscometers.
Sawa cleaners are repaired at Seika’s demo center in Torrance, CA. The McDry drying units are repaired at the Atlanta office & demo center, and repair kits are available as well. Malcom viscometers can be calibrated and serviced for light maintenance at the company’s San Francisco office.
Seika Machinery offers world-class sales and support for its machinery, equipment and automation solutions used in various industries. In addition to service and repairs, the team provides technical service including installation and on-site training for dedicated products.
